Output 38430dc15f5d0ec8197054ca0f8698e1965911e9b52930d3523a894757d77f52:1

value
31756000
script pubkey
OP_0 OP_PUSHBYTES_20 589b26906e89a44425deed93a4df3f010977b8a9
address
ltc1qtzdjdyrw3xjygfw7akf6fhelqyyh0w9fz99jpt
transaction
38430dc15f5d0ec8197054ca0f8698e1965911e9b52930d3523a894757d77f52
spent
true